Leveraging Data and Artificial Intelligence for Efficient Employee Training in Environmental Compliance within Waste Management
In today's rapidly evolving waste management sector, ensuring compliance with environmental regulations is crucial for organizations. Proper employee training plays a pivotal role in guaranteeing adherence to these regulations, minimizing environmental impact, and maintaining a safe working environment. With the advent of data analytics and artificial intelligence (AI), organizations can now create relevant employee training courses in record time, enabling them to stay ahead in this dynamic industry.
The Power of Data in Employee Training:
Data holds the key to understanding the specific training needs of employees in waste management. By analyzing historical data, organizations can identify recurring compliance issues, areas of improvement, and knowledge gaps among their workforce. This data-driven approach allows companies to tailor training programs to address specific shortcomings and provide targeted learning experiences to employees.
Utilizing Artificial Intelligence for Efficient Training:
Artificial intelligence has revolutionized various industries, and employee training in waste management is no exception. AI-powered systems can process vast amounts of data, identify patterns, and generate actionable insights. By harnessing AI algorithms, organizations can automate the development of training content, making it faster and more efficient than ever before.
1. Personalized Training Paths:
AI can analyze individual employee data, such as job roles, performance records, and areas of expertise, to create personalized training paths. Such tailored courses ensure that employees receive the most relevant and effective training, saving time and resources.
2. Real-Time Feedback and Assessment:
AI-powered systems can provide real-time feedback during training sessions, enabling employees to address knowledge gaps immediately. By using predictive algorithms, AI can also assess employees' progress and recommend additional training modules to ensure comprehensive learning.
3. Virtual Reality Simulations:
Virtual reality (VR) technology, combined with AI, can create immersive and realistic training simulations for waste management employees. These simulations replicate real-life scenarios, allowing employees to practice compliance procedures, emergency response protocols, and waste handling techniques in a safe and controlled environment.
Benefits of Fast and Relevant Employee Training:
Implementing data-driven and AI-supported training programs in waste management offers several advantages:
1. Reduced Training Time:
Traditional training methods are often time-consuming, requiring extensive manual efforts. By leveraging data and AI, organizations can significantly reduce the time spent on developing and delivering training modules, ensuring that employees receive up-to-date knowledge promptly.
2. Cost Savings:
Efficient training programs result in reduced costs associated with travel, accommodation, and instructor fees. Moreover, AI-based training courses eliminate the need for physical training facilities, making training more accessible and cost-effective.
3. Improved Compliance:
By addressing specific knowledge gaps and providing targeted training, organizations can enhance their employees' compliance with environmental regulations. This not only ensures a safer working environment but also minimizes the risk of non-compliance penalties and reputational damage.
